        # Update an environment.
        # @param [String] name
        #   The relative resource name of the environment to update, in the form:
        #   "projects/`projectId`/locations/`locationId`/environments/`environmentId`"
        # @param [Google::Apis::ComposerV1::Environment] environment_object
        # @param [String] update_mask
        #   Required. A comma-separated list of paths, relative to `Environment`, of
        #   fields to update.
        #   For example, to set the version of scikit-learn to install in the
        #   environment to 0.19.0 and to remove an existing installation of
        #   numpy, the `updateMask` parameter would include the following two
        #   `paths` values: "config.softwareConfig.pypiPackages.scikit-learn" and
        #   "config.softwareConfig.pypiPackages.numpy". The included patch
        #   environment would specify the scikit-learn version as follows:
        #   `
        #   "config":`
        #   "softwareConfig":`
        #   "pypiPackages":`
        #   "scikit-learn":"==0.19.0"
        #   `
        #   `
        #   `
        #   `
        #   Note that in the above example, any existing PyPI packages
        #   other than scikit-learn and numpy will be unaffected.
        #   Only one update type may be included in a single request's `updateMask`.
        #   For example, one cannot update both the PyPI packages and
        #   labels in the same request. However, it is possible to update multiple
        #   members of a map field simultaneously in the same request. For example,
        #   to set the labels "label1" and "label2" while clearing "label3" (assuming
        #   it already exists), one can
        #   provide the paths "labels.label1", "labels.label2", and "labels.label3"
        #   and populate the patch environment as follows:
        #   `
        #   "labels":`
        #   "label1":"new-label1-value"
        #   "label2":"new-label2-value"
        #   `
        #   `
        #   Note that in the above example, any existing labels that are not
        #   included in the `updateMask` will be unaffected.
        #   It is also possible to replace an entire map field by providing the
        #   map field's path in the `updateMask`. The new value of the field will
        #   be that which is provided in the patch environment. For example, to
        #   delete all pre-existing user-specified PyPI packages and
        #   install botocore at version 1.7.14, the `updateMask` would contain
        #   the path "config.softwareConfig.pypiPackages", and
        #   the patch environment would be the following:
        #   `
        #   "config":`
        #   "softwareConfig":`
        #   "pypiPackages":`
        #   "botocore":"==1.7.14"
        #   `
        #   `
        #   `
        #   `
        #   **Note:** Only the following fields can be updated:
        #   <table>
        #   <tbody>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td><strong>Mask</strong></td>
        #   <td><strong>Purpose</strong></td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>config.softwareConfig.pypiPackages
        #   </td>
        #   <td>Replace all custom custom PyPI packages. If a replacement
        #   package map is not included in `environment`, all custom
        #   PyPI packages are cleared. It is an error to provide both this mask and a
        #   mask specifying an individual package.</td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>config.softwareConfig.pypiPackages.<var>packagename</var></td>
        #   <td>Update the custom PyPI package <var>packagename</var>,
        #   preserving other packages. To delete the package, include it in
        #   `updateMask`, and omit the mapping for it in
        #   `environment.config.softwareConfig.pypiPackages`. It is an error
        #   to provide both a mask of this form and the
        #   "config.softwareConfig.pypiPackages" mask.</td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>labels</td>
        #   <td>Replace all environment labels. If a replacement labels map is not
        #   included in `environment`, all labels are cleared. It is an error to
        #   provide both this mask and a mask specifying one or more individual
        #   labels.</td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>labels.<var>labelName</var></td>
        #   <td>Set the label named <var>labelName</var>, while preserving other
        #   labels. To delete the label, include it in `updateMask` and omit its
        #   mapping in `environment.labels`. It is an error to provide both a
        #   mask of this form and the "labels" mask.</td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>config.nodeCount</td>
        #   <td>Horizontally scale the number of nodes in the environment. An integer
        #   greater than or equal to 3 must be provided in the `config.nodeCount`
        #   field.
        #   </td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>config.softwareConfig.airflowConfigOverrides</td>
        #   <td>Replace all Apache Airflow config overrides. If a replacement config
        #   overrides map is not included in `environment`, all config overrides
        #   are cleared.
        #   It is an error to provide both this mask and a mask specifying one or
        #   more individual config overrides.</td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>config.softwareConfig.airflowConfigOverrides.<var>section</var>-<var>name
        #   </var></td>
        #   <td>Override the Apache Airflow config property <var>name</var> in the
        #   section named <var>section</var>, preserving other properties. To delete
        #   the property override, include it in `updateMask` and omit its mapping
        #   in `environment.config.softwareConfig.airflowConfigOverrides`.
        #   It is an error to provide both a mask of this form and the
        #   "config.softwareConfig.airflowConfigOverrides" mask.</td>
        #   </tr>
        #   <tr>
        #   <td>config.softwareConfig.envVariables</td>
        #   <td>Replace all environment variables. If a replacement environment
        #   variable map is not included in `environment`, all custom environment
        #   variables  are cleared.
        #   It is an error to provide both this mask and a mask specifying one or
        #   more individual environment variables.</td>
        #   </tr>
        #   </tbody>
        #   </table>
        # @param [String] fields
        #   Selector specifying which fields to include in a partial response.
        # @param [String] quota_user
        #   Available to use for quota purposes for server-side applications. Can be any
        #   arbitrary string assigned to a user, but should not exceed 40 characters.
        # @param [Google::Apis::RequestOptions] options
        #   Request-specific options
        #
        # @yield [result, err] Result & error if block supplied
        # @yieldparam result [Google::Apis::ComposerV1::Operation] parsed result object
        # @yieldparam err [StandardError] error object if request failed
        #
        # @return [Google::Apis::ComposerV1::Operation]
        #
        # @raise [Google::Apis::ServerError] An error occurred on the server and the request can be retried
        # @raise [Google::Apis::ClientError] The request is invalid and should not be retried without modification
        # @raise [Google::Apis::AuthorizationError] Authorization is required
        def patch_project_location_environment(name, environment_object = nil, update_mask: nil, fields: nil, quota_user: nil, options: nil, &block)
          command = make_simple_command(:patch, 'v1/{+name}', options)
          command.request_representation = Google::Apis::ComposerV1::Environment::Representation
          command.request_object = environment_object
          command.response_representation = Google::Apis::ComposerV1::Operation::Representation
          command.response_class = Google::Apis::ComposerV1::Operation
          command.params['name'] = name unless name.nil?
          command.query['updateMask'] = update_mask unless update_mask.nil?
          command.query['fields'] = fields unless fields.nil?
          command.query['quotaUser'] = quota_user unless quota_user.nil?
          execute_or_queue_command(command, &block)
        end
